Full Job Description
Missions
- Ensure growth with the Customers via profitable order intake
- Manage the customer relationship
- Represent Sales in the operation team
- Identify and evaluate new business opportunities and adjacent market opportunities (new services / new standards)
- Meet sales targets and revenue growth targets.
- Drive the negotiation during Business Acquisition process
- Deliver commercial insights
- Determine the sales price objectives according to his knowledge of the market and competitors' position (through Customer information and Marketing feed-back)
- Prepare the budget, manage and report the selling prices and the order intake target list
- Responsible for the turnover and its evolution for the Customer(s)
- Manage the relationship with the customer in case of claims and logistic/quality crisis
- Monitor and take the necessary actions to reduce overdue
- Manage and build strong professional relationships directly with customers and internal stakeholders
- Develop and maintain high level prospect relationships through regular face to face meetings
- Promote and maintain high level of customer satisfaction.
- Ensure the competitiveness and full-compliance of Utac offers with the expectations and requirements of the Customer:
- Work together with KAMs in other Regions to ensure global consistency
- Initiate and conduct all possible actions in order to be able to submit, within the time limits, a competitive quotation economically and technically (with the support of the operation team)
- Participate in Project Teams in order to explain and defend the Customer's view in terms of quality, costs, delivery times and in order to satisfy their requirements.
